DEACON Herbert N. "Herb," 81 years, formerly of West Milford, New Jersey and presently of Liverpool, PA., passed away on Tuesday, August 25, 2009 at the Carolyn Croxton Slane Residence, Harrisburg, PA.He was born on July 14, 1928, at Paterson, New Jersey, a son of the late Louis A. and Margaret...
